Transaction 189ec4d0d32dc33bd92693079fcac575efbb51ef8cbc18fcbfb92b431a1f2d60
2 Input
2 Outputs
- 189ec4d0d32dc33bd92693079fcac575efbb51ef8cbc18fcbfb92b431a1f2d60:0
- 189ec4d0d32dc33bd92693079fcac575efbb51ef8cbc18fcbfb92b431a1f2d60:1
value 7443759
address 12RH5zxjQWfV25JFsprXJ7QcY2LeWMVMRK
value 386472
address 1PfhatLxu6DCpTCxXaG3HdhfkWv7FqX5SX